

One of the most prominent cryptocurrency exchanges stands as a dominant force in the global digital asset market. Established in 2017, this platform has rapidly grown to become the world's largest cryptocurrency exchange by trading volume. The exchange's popularity stems from its user-friendly interface, extensive cryptocurrency offerings, and competitive fee structure with rates as low as 0.1% or lower.
The platform's growth trajectory is remarkable, with several key achievements highlighting its market position. By the end of 2024, this exchange reached 250 million registered users, representing a substantial 47% increase from 2023. The platform has processed cumulative trading volumes exceeding $100 trillion and maintains an operational presence in over 100 countries worldwide.
However, this exchange's expansion has not been without challenges. The platform has encountered significant regulatory hurdles in various jurisdictions, leading to its withdrawal from markets including Canada and Australia. Additionally, the exchange faced considerable controversy when its CEO Changpeng Zhao resigned and subsequently faced criminal charges in the United States, marking a significant moment in the company's history.
This leading exchange has implemented a comprehensive security infrastructure designed to protect user assets and maintain platform integrity. The platform employs multiple layers of security measures that work in conjunction to create a robust defense system against potential threats.
The exchange utilizes end-to-end encryption for all transactions, ensuring that data remains secure during transmission. A critical security measure is the use of cold wallet storage, where the majority of customer funds are kept offline, significantly reducing exposure to potential online attacks and hacking attempts.
Two-factor authentication (2FA) provides users with an additional security layer beyond traditional password protection. This feature ensures that even if a malicious actor obtains account credentials, they cannot access the account without the secondary authentication factor.
The platform leverages artificial intelligence technology for real-time monitoring and threat detection. In 2024 alone, the exchange's AI systems sent more than 15,000 daily alerts to users, helping prevent potential security breaches and fraudulent activities. Users also benefit from access control features, including the ability to whitelist wallet addresses and restrict API access based on IP addresses.
One of the platform's most significant security features is the Secure Asset Fund for Users (SAFU), a $1 billion insurance fund specifically maintained to reimburse users in the event of a security breach or hack. Furthermore, the exchange's fraud prevention efforts in 2024 resulted in blacklisting 47,000 malicious addresses, preventing an estimated $129 million in losses. Through its Anti-Scam Refund Initiative, the platform successfully recovered $9.1 million for affected users.
This major exchange's global expansion has been accompanied by significant regulatory challenges across multiple jurisdictions, requiring the platform to adapt its operations to comply with varying international standards.
The platform has faced intense global scrutiny, particularly in developed markets with stringent financial regulations. In recent years, the exchange withdrew from several countries including Canada, Australia, and the Netherlands due to mounting regulatory pressure. These withdrawals left users in affected regions temporarily unable to trade or access their funds, highlighting the impact of regulatory compliance on platform accessibility.
In the United States, the international platform was required to cease operations, prompting the company to launch a separate U.S. entity. This American platform was specifically designed to comply with U.S. regulations and operates under a different structure, offering fewer cryptocurrencies and a modified fee schedule compared to its international counterpart. Despite these limitations, the U.S. platform is considered a safe and secure option for American users.
Perhaps the most serious challenge involved money laundering-related violations. The exchange paid more than $4 billion in fines related to these infractions, marking one of the largest regulatory settlements in cryptocurrency history. The controversy culminated in CEO Changpeng Zhao's resignation and a four-month prison sentence in the United States.
In response to these challenges, the platform has undertaken significant efforts to strengthen its compliance framework. By 2024, the company expanded its compliance team to over 650 professionals and secured 21 regulatory licenses across various countries, demonstrating its commitment to operating within legal frameworks.

While this leading platform implements robust security measures, users should be aware of several inherent risks associated with using the exchange.
Platform breaches represent a significant concern for any cryptocurrency exchange. This platform has experienced multiple security incidents throughout its history. However, it's important to note that the company has utilized its insurance fund to fully compensate affected users for lost assets, demonstrating its commitment to protecting customer interests even when security measures are compromised.
Phishing scams pose an ongoing threat to users of this exchange. Malicious actors frequently impersonate platform support representatives in attempts to gain unauthorized access to customer accounts. While this type of social engineering attack is not unique to this platform and occurs across the entire cryptocurrency ecosystem, users must remain vigilant against such threats. These scams typically involve fraudulent communications requesting account credentials or sensitive information.
Regulatory risks present perhaps the most unpredictable challenge for users. The platform's history of withdrawing from markets like Canada, Australia, and the Netherlands demonstrates that regulatory pressures can suddenly impact service availability. If the exchange ceases operations in a user's region, they must act quickly to transfer funds to alternative platforms or wallets to avoid losing access to their cryptocurrency holdings.
Protecting your cryptocurrency assets requires proactive security measures beyond relying solely on the exchange's built-in protections.
Enabling two-factor authentication (2FA) should be your first priority when setting up an account on this platform. This additional security layer significantly reduces the risk of unauthorized access, even if your password is compromised. The extra step during login provides crucial protection against account takeover attempts.
Password security forms the foundation of account protection. Create strong, unique passwords that combine u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and special characters. Avoid reusing passwords across multiple platforms, as a breach on one service could compromise all accounts sharing the same credentials. Consider using a reputable password manager to generate and securely store complex passwords.
Protecting against phishing attacks requires constant vigilance. Never click on suspicious links, especially those received via email or social media claiming to be from the exchange. Be extremely cautious of anyone claiming to be a support representative, as legitimate platform staff will never ask for your password or 2FA codes. Always verify communications by logging directly into your account through the official website or app rather than following provided links.
Installing and maintaining antivirus software such as MalwareBytes provides an additional defensive layer against cybersecurity threats. Regular system scans can detect and remove malicious software that might attempt to steal your credentials or compromise your account security.
For long-term cryptocurrency storage, strongly consider withdrawing assets from the exchange to a private custodial wallet. Cold wallets, which store private keys offline, offer the highest level of security by eliminating exposure to online threats. While centralized exchanges like this one implement strong security measures, maintaining personal custody of your assets provides the ultimate protection against platform-related risks.
